Klíčová slova: Kryptoanalýza kryptosystémů s veřejným klíčem, Distribuovaná aplikace, Problém faktorizace čísel, Problém diskrétního logaritmu, Numerické metody 6 Abstract The thesis studies the potential of distributed application in crypt- analysis of public–key cryptosystems. There is an explanation of the relation among a popular public–key cryptosystems, such as RSA cypher, Diffie–Hellman key exchange and ElGamal cypher, and solving of integer factorization or discrete logarithm problem. There exists numerical methods for solving of these problems, the most effective ones are described in this thesis. In the caseof solving discrete logarithm problems there are described method such as Shank’s baby–step giant–step algorithm and Index calculus method. For the purpose of solving integer factorization problem there are described methods such as Pollard’s rho method, Dixon’s random square method, Quadratic Sieve and General number field sieve. The theme of the theses was solved by creating of distributed application. It is the composition of the web application and the desktop application. The web application represents master nod in the distributed system. It is usable for managing of task in the sys- tem for the users. It also provides basic functionality for distribut- ing of the tasks to the slave nods. The slave nod is represented by the desktop application. It is the part where there are implemented described numerical methods for solving of integer factorization or discrete logarithm problem. Finally there is an analysis of usability of the distributed application for real situations. It consists of mea- surements of efficiency of methods and its potentials in distributed applications. It is shown that distributed application represents usable approach for solving of this kind of problems. However it is also shown that if cryptographers does not do any mistake during implementation of described cryptosystems, it is almost impossi- ble to be successful with cryptanalysis of such system. The thesis analyzes important issue related with security of public–key cryp- tosystems of nowadays. This issue is relevant not only for scientific purposes but has also many practical consequences. In the beginning of thesis there is a description of relation among public–key cryptosystems and solving of discrete logarithm or integer factorization problem. There are only most popular cryptosystems described in this part, which include RSA cypher, Diffie–Hellman key exchange algorithm and ElGamal cypher. The security RSA cypher is related with solving of integer factorization problem, which could be described as finding prime factors 푝 and 푞 of number 푛 such that 푛 = 푝 ⋅ 푞. The rest of cryptosystems are based on solving of discrete logarithm problem, which could be described as finding integer 푥 of congruence 푔푥 ≡ 푎 (mod 푝) where 푔, 푎 and 푝 are known integers. Solving of these kinds of problems is enormously time consuming process. By using of brute force method it is almost impossible to be successful in finding solution of relatively trivial task in some rational time – means for example less than one year. There exists some algorithms how to solve these kinds of problems that are much more effective than brute force – these are described in the following chapters.
